Today, weβre going to dive into the critical aspect of recording data in fitness testing. Why do you think accurate data recording is so important, Student_1?
I think itβs essential because without accurate data, we canβt assess an athleteβs performance correctly.
Exactly! Accurate data helps us make informed decisions. Letβs remember the acronym 'A.R.E.': Accurate, Reliable, Effectual. These are key for effective data recording. What else might happen if data is not recorded correctly, Student_2?
It could lead to wrong conclusions about an athleteβs capabilities or progress.
Correct! Misinterpretations can negatively impact training. To ensure accuracy, we can use organized data sheets. Can anyone tell me what should be included in these sheets, Student_3?
Maybe participant details, test conditions, and the actual test results?
Spot on! We also need to note any anomalies, like if the participant was sick. This holistic approach ensures we have all the context for our analysis.
In summary, recording data accurately ensures we develop reliable insights that benefit athletesβ training. Keep the A.R.E. acronym in mind!

β Use clear, organized data sheets.
When recording data from fitness tests, it's crucial to use data sheets that are well-structured. This means that all the information should be easy to read and locate. An organized layout helps ensure that no important details are overlooked, which in turn supports accurate analysis later on.
Think of a well-organized data sheet like a clean, labeled filing cabinet. Just like having organized files makes it easy to find documents quickly, clear data sheets allow trainers and coaches to access information rapidly, which is essential for making informed decisions.

β Include participant details, test conditions, and results.
It's vital to document specific details about each participant in the test. This includes their name, age, sex, and any relevant background information, as well as the conditions under which the tests were conducted (like temperature and time of day). Additionally, the actual results of the fitness tests must be accurately noted. These details help contextualize the data and enhance the reliability of the tests.
Imagine cooking a complex recipeβitβs essential to note down not just the ingredients but also the cooking time and temperature. Similarly, having comprehensive records of participants and conditions allows for a clearer interpretation of the fitness results.

β Note any anomalies (e.g., participant illness, weather).
It is important to document any unusual occurrences that might affect the results of the tests, such as if a participant was feeling ill on test day or if the weather conditions were not ideal. This information is critical when analyzing the data laterβit helps clarify if results were influenced by factors outside of a participant's control.
Consider a science experiment where you have to note down any unexpected changes, like the room temperature or equipment malfunction. Noting such anomalies helps you understand why certain results occurred, ensuring that conclusions drawn from the data are valid.
